The cost of siding hole patching in Charlotte, NC can vary greatly depending on several factors. Homeowners often find themselves needing to repair holes in their siding due to weather damage, accidents, or general wear and tear. Understanding the different factors that influence the cost can help you budget for this necessary home maintenance task.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Siding: Different materials like vinyl, wood, or fiber cement have varying costs.
- Size of the Hole: Larger holes require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Charlotte, NC can impact the overall price.
- Extent of Damage: Additional damage around the hole may require more extensive repairs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require special equipment, adding to the cost.
- Urgency: Emergency repairs may come with a premium charge.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Charlotte, NC) |
---|---|
Small Hole Patching (Vinyl) | $50 - $150 |
Medium Hole Patching (Wood) | $100 - $250 |
Large Hole Patching (Fiber Cement) | $200 - $400 |
Full Siding Panel Replacement | $300 - $600 |
Labor Costs per Hour | $40 - $75 |
